Deskripsi Pekerjaan

  • • We have exciting new projects
  • • We are a subsidiary of a top-notch Government-Owned company
  • • You will have outstanding career development opportunities


Are you we are looking for?
  • Develop and translate designs and wireframes into high quality code based on business requirements
  • Responsible for the scalability, robustness, and reliability of all solutions within the application area
  • Design, build, and maintain high performance, reusable, and reliable Java code
  • Responsible for defining and following best practices
  • Identify and correct bottlenecks and fix bugs
  • Evaluate, suggest and implement third party software as needed
  • Help maintain code quality, organization, and automatization
  • Pro-actively consult industry best practices in software design and integration solutions.
Basic qualifications:
  • Ability to communicate and interact with business partners and collaboratively define solutions to address key opportunities.
  • Ability to jointly and independently make decisions, defines required changes, and communicates modifications to entire project team.
iOS programmer qualification:
  • min. 1 year experience of developing with Java, C++, swift or other object oriented platforms
  • min. 1 year experience of mobile application development on iOS platform using Objective C or Swift
  • Experienced in a structured and formal software development processes
  • Experienced in developing in an Agile / SCRUM Environment
  • Experienced in developing mission-critical applications
  • Have knowledge on Mobile Platform Architectures
  • Experienced in deploying an application to the App Store
  • Have knowledge on REST, JSON, and MySql
  • Have strong business and technical acumen
  • Have excellent verbal and written communication skill
  • Able to keep informed of industry trends and technologies and apply them quickly
Android programmer qualification:
  • Strong knowledge of Android SDK, different versions of Android, and how to deal with different screen sizes
  • Strong knowledge of JAVA OOP
  • Ability to understand business requirements and translate them into technical requirements
  • Familiarity with RESTful APIs (WSDL, SOAP, REST) to connect Android applications to back-end services
  • Having knowledge about SQL and RDBMS(MySQL, SQL Server, Postgre, SQLite, etc.)
  • Strong knowledge of Android UI design principles, patterns, and best practices
  • Experience with offline storage, threading, and performance tuning
  • Familiarity with cloud message APIs and push notifications
  • Having android development experience at least 1 year
  • Having knowledge about android class design patterns (Singleton, Builder, Adapter)
  • Having knowledge about android studio
  • Having knowledge about MVC Framework, Hibernate, and Spring

Lowongan Kerja Rekomendasi